cocoa beach surf report
Monday: Mostly knee to thigh high wind swell waves at 5 sec from the ENE. SE winds in the mid teens are chopping things up. There are a few ridable sections out there but you have to work for it.
cocoa beach surf forecast
Tuesday: Knee to thigh continues at around 6 sec from East with a little ENE background bump. Morning winds looks decent. Light South winds to start the day switch to SE and build as the day goes on.
Looking ahead: The longer period background swell should fill in a little. Nothing big but more organized. Winds look good for the AM especially north of the Cape so Wednesday morning may be worth checking out.
We should see a similar set up for Thursday with the morning being the cleaner time to paddle out again.
Size will drop off for Friday with decent SW morning winds. The weekend should continue with lingering knee to thigh longer period ENE swell in the water.

cocoa beach surf break information
The Cocoa Beach Pier breaks on almost every type of swell! North swells are best in the chest to head high zone. South West winds will are perfect for grooming the sets.
Widely known as the surfing capital of the East Coast, the primary attraction to Cocoa Beach is the weather. With its prime positioning where two climatic zones (sub-tropic and temperate) meet, our weather usually avoids extremes. This unique coastal location attracts wildlife indigenous to both climatic zones, as well as migratory species and it is the primary tourist destination on the Florida Space Coast.
In downtown Cocoa Beach near Minuteman Causeway, an area known as Cottage Row offers a variety of specialty shops set up in charming old Naval housing. Cafes, nightclubs, and fine-dining establishments flank art galleries, bike rentals, and specialized surf shops. With an active nightlife and array of eateries, Cocoa Beach has established itself as an exciting locale among visitors as well as locals. Enjoy live music on the Party Deck at Coconuts On The Beach or the very fine martinis at Heidi’s Jazz Club.
Ron Jon Surf Shop is a destination unto itself as the “World’s Most Famous Surf Shop.” The Cocoa Beach Surf Company surf complex next door is another must see as it includes a hotel, surf school, travel agency, and tour operator. Cocoa Beach is also famous as the location of the “I Dream of Jeannie” television show that aired in the 70s. The Sunday Farmer’s Market and the nature trail at Lori Wilson Park are enjoyable excursions to add to any Cocoa Beach getaway.
